The blade-wielding man dashed forward several more steps.

Suddenly, his entire body erupted with a crimson glow as he shifted to gripping his massive blade with both hands. The already broad weapon expanded further, now twice the size of his own body.

With a violent pivot, the man turned.

"You want the Soul Bone? Let’s see if you can survive to claim it!" His frenzied roar shook the entire forest.

The surrounding woods echoed with startled shrieks and hoofbeats as countless Spirit Beasts were disturbed by the commotion.

The man leaped high, bringing his blade crashing down toward his pursuers.

This must be the Xiahou Mang Old Snake ntioned! Dugu Feng marveled at the overwhelming aura. This power feels beyond just a Soul Emperor.

The Blade Soul was known for its domineering, unyielding offensive power, and Xiahou Mang’s technique resembled the Weapon Soul Avatar - man and blade becoming one. No wonder his family beca a subsidiary of the Clear Sky Sect; their styles shared similarities.

Xiahou Mang had completely rged with his colossal blade, his movents inseparable from the weapon’s path. To Dugu Feng’s eyes, the world seed filled with nothing but flashing steel.

"Six years ago you escaped. Now you’ve reached Soul Saint rank, but today your luck runs out!" bood a thunderous voice.

Dugu Feng saw streaks of white light that, upon closer inspection, revealed themselves to be reflections off white scales illuminated by Spirit Rings. Three powerfully built figures covered in white scales advanced - the leader bearing seven Spirit Rings (Yellow, Yellow, Purple, Purple, Black, Black, Black), flanked by two others with Yellow, Yellow, Purple, Purple, Purple, Black configurations. The voice had co from the leading Soul Saint.

One Soul Saint and two Soul Emperors.

Their white scale armor identified them as White Armored Earth Dragon users - mbers of the Sacred Dragon Sect?

The trio emitted intense white light that coalesced into a massive spectral white dragon. The apparition swayed through the air before colliding violently with the crimson blade energy.

BOOM!

A devastating shockwave radiated outward, leveling dozens of surrounding trees.

Xiahou Mang, still rged with his blade, staggered backward from the impact while the three Sacred Dragon Soul Masters grimaced, suppressing their churning blood and energy. The clash had been nearly evenly matched.

Suddenly, the earth trembled violently as if struck by an earthquake.

An enormous figure over three ters tall burst from the side, its form barely humanoid. Yet Dugu Feng recognized it as a mber of the Huyan family - their Diamond Mammoth Martial Soul.

This mammoth Soul Master charged directly toward Xiahou Mang with unstoppable montum.

"The Elephant Armor Sect working with Sacred Dragon Sect? Has Elephant Armor also pledged allegiance to Spirit Hall? Or have all Five Elent Academies surrendered to them?" Old Snake’s thoughts turned grim - this was no trivial developnt.

Xiahou Mang, still recovering from his clash with the Sacred Dragon fighters, found himself caught mid-transition between spent and renewed strength. The tank-like Diamond Mammoth struck him squarely, sending his body flying backward as he coughed up blood.

"Die now!" The Sacred Dragon Soul Saint advanced rcilessly.

Xiahou Mang’s eyes burned with ferocity as he gripped his massive blade. His earlier escape had already drained much of his Soul Power. Now facing two Soul Saints - including this Sacred Dragon expert whose White Armored Earth Dragon, though a lesser dragon variant, ranked among the strongest at Soul Saint level with terrifying speed - he found himself hard-pressed on all fronts.

The Elephant Armor Sect’s Huyan Lie was particularly thick-skinned and tough, practically impossible to kill.

The battle erupted once more.

Xiahou Mang’s Soul Bone was also revealed—a dull yellow helt that appeared on his head, unremarkable and unadorned.

Yet it was a genuine Spirit Bone Ability.

His Soul Bone was a defensive skull bone, the very sa one Huyan Li had used during the Soul Master Competition.

Seeing this, Dugu Feng couldn’t help but feel disappointed.

This wasn’t a particularly powerful Soul Bone. Even if it were offered to him, he might not have wanted it.

After all, he possessed the Core Pearl, so the urgency to resist the dangers of poison backlash wasn’t as pressing.

If he were to absorb a Soul Bone, it would have to be at least fifty-thousand years old—preferably a hundred-thousand-year one. Tang San’s Soul Bones were mostly hundred-thousand-year, after all.

He couldn’t afford to fall short.

This skull bone, at best, was only ten-thousand years old.

The fact that Xiahou Mang had resorted to using his Soul Bone ant he was nearing his limit.

This wasn’t the first ti they had fought.

Xiahou Mang had fled multiple tis, only to be caught again.

On this night, despair began to creep into Xiahou Mang’s heart.

"Co this way!" A sudden voice transmission reached Xiahou Mang’s ears.

His eyes lit up—soone was hiding nearby.

He quickly retreated in the direction of the voice, cautiously fighting as he moved.

The voice had naturally co from Old Snake.

Old Snake chuckled darkly.

The prey had indeed walked right into the trap.

Then, in Dugu Feng’s perception, the surrounding toxins thickened. The air was filled with the colorless, odorless Azure Phosphorus Violet Venom.

This version of the venom was far more concealed than the one condensed from his first Soul Skill.

Not only were the particles minuscule, making them difficult to detect with spiritual power, but they were also completely undetectable by sight or sll.

Clearly, Old Snake had mastered the Azure Phosphorus Violet Venom to an extrely profound level.

Dugu Feng could sense it only because his Core Pearl was vibrating. He quickly suppressed it—the high-quality venom seed to stir an unusual eagerness in the pearl.

Now, it was ti to witness Old Snake’s silent killing technique.

Just how lethal could a poison-attribute Soul Master truly be?

But in the next mont, an unexpected turn of events occurred.

"Now!"

Xiahou Mang, who had been retreating, suddenly roared and turned, leaping toward Dugu Feng’s hiding spot.

Xiahou Mang was ruthless. After approaching Old Snake’s vicinity, he had naturally detected Dugu Feng as well.

Dugu Feng had hidden perfectly.

But the gap between a one-ring Soul Master and a Soul Saint was simply too vast.

Once Xiahou Mang knew soone was hiding here, he had no trouble spotting Dugu Feng.

However, he hadn’t detected Old Snake.

Instantly, he realized that this weak Soul Master must be connected to the person who had secretly transmitted to him.

Who wouldn’t covet a Soul Bone?

Xiahou Mang had no intention of entrusting his life to soone else.

So, while shouting, he was also alerting Huyan Lie to the presence of others nearby.

He wanted the two sides to clash, giving him a chance to escape.

To avoid surprises, he even planned to seize Dugu Feng first—if the hidden party was powerful, this would at least make them hesitate.

A re one-ring Soul Master?

He could capture him in an instant.

If the hidden party thought they could reap the rewards without effort, they were sorely mistaken.

A vicious glint flashed in Xiahou Mang’s eyes. As he closed the distance, he finally got a clear look at Dugu Feng—a child.

Very young.

But it was a sha. Even if he escaped after capturing him, he wouldn’t spare the boy’s life.

He could already guess that the child’s face would show a look of terror.

But the next mont, Xiahou Mang was surprised.

The child actually smiled?

Had he lost his mind from fear?

Well, it made sense. He had never seen such an aloof and domineering Soul Saint before, nor had he ever witnessed a Spirit Bone Ability. After all, he was still just a child!

What an innocent age—pity he was about to die.
